Map lights not working
My 2006 2LT with sunroof and rear view mirror with compass and onstar ect has map lights in the bottom of the mirror assembly. The map lights function as they should when doors are opened and closed, but if I try to turn them on manually by pushing the button switch on the bottom of the mirror they no longer function. In the past you would push the button switch to activate and shut off the map lights, now neither the driver or passenger side map light will operate manually. The switch in the rear seat for the interior lighting is set to the proper position and the dimming light for interior lights on a 2006 has no affect on the map lights. I've read all related posts and am out of ideas, any help would be appreciated. Thanks
